Your role

Key responsibilities as follows:

  • Work within the Engineering Operations team at the Kalgoorlie site.
  • Engage in maintenance and problem-solving for plant assets.
  • Participate in planned and reactive maintenance and shutdowns.
  • Manage local controls and systems, depending on your engineering discipline.

About you

Candidates should possess the following:

  • A Bachelor, Post Graduate, or Master’s degree in Electrical, Control Systems, Mechanical, or Chemical/Process Engineering.
  • Graduation completed in 2023 or 2024.
  • Full working rights in Australia and a valid driving license.

Benefits

Orica offers an attractive salary package, domestic relocation assistance, and comprehensive benefits.

Training & development

The role includes a targeted development pathway, mentorship from senior leaders, and a buddy system with experienced staff.

Career progression

Upon completing the 2-year program, transition into a permanent position with opportunities for rotation to other locations such as Helidon, Deer Park, Kooragang Island, or Yarwun.
